Tasting Experience

Cáceres’s culinary delights await participants as they indulge in a tasting experience featuring local specialties that capture the essence of Extremaduran gastronomy.
Guests savor the rich flavors of Torta del Casar, a creamy cheese, alongside Patatera, a savory spread made from potatoes and spices. Almogrote, a delightful cheese paste, tantalizes the taste buds, making for a truly authentic experience.
To complement these local delicacies, participants enjoy a selection of fine local wines, enhancing the tasting session. Each bite and sip tells a story of the region’s traditions and ingredients.
